An Anatomy of Skepticism

Skeptical Inquirer,  Sept-Oct, 2007  by Kendrick Frazier

AN ANATOMY OF SKEPTICISM. Manfred Weidhorn. iUniverse, Lincoln, Nebraska (www.iuniverse.com), 2006. 429 pp. Softcover, $27.95. Although the author insists this lengthy work is not a systematic treatise on skepticism or a work of philosophy, it is a philosophical examination of skepticism in the context of life and culture.

Surveying the state of knowledge in some nonscientific disciplines--religion, politics and history, psychology, literature, and words and reason--and, especially, in the "highways and byways of daily life," he finds widespread uncertainty behind the mask of certitude. Behind this undermining of convictions are, he finds, the "slipperiness of assumptions" and the "virtual impossibility" of finding truth.
